Passing the Plate or...?


“So the king commanded, and they made a chest and set it outside by the gate of the house of the Lord.  And they made a proclamation in Judah and Jerusalem to bring to the Lord the levy fixed by Moses, the servant of God on Israel in the wilderness

“And all the officers and all the people rejoiced and brought in their levies and dropped them into the chest until they had finished.  And it came about whenever the chest was brought in to the king’s officer by the Levites, and when they saw that there was much money, then the king’s scribe and the chief priest’s officer would come, empty the chest, take it and return it to its place.  Thus they did daily and collected much money.

“And the king and Jehoiada gave it to those who did the work of the service of the house of the Lord, and they hired masons and carpenters to restore the house of the Lord, and also workers in iron and bronze to repair the house of the Lord.” II Chronicles 24:8-13

Do you remember the first time someone passed you the plate in Church?  You might have been excited to be so grown-up or embarrassed because you didn’t have much money and didn’t know how much was expected.  Or it may have been a reflective time of humility and careful devotion, even generosity. 

No matter what your first recollection might be, the Lord never needs anyone to give Him anything.  Remember, all the cattle on a thousand hills? 

Then why do we give in His name?  We do this as if it is Christmas and Easter every day -- as an expression of thanksgiving and remembrance for all He has provided for us.  His provision comes from such lovingkindness and patience and most of all forgiveness even before we asked.

“For while we were still helpless, at the right time Christ died for the ungodly.  For one will hardly die for a righteous man; though perhaps for the good man someone would dare even to die.  But God demonstrates His own love toward us in that while we were yet sinners, Christ died for us.”  Romans 5:6-8

Sing NOW?!


A huge army has threatened the land of Israel and…

“And Jehoshaphat was afraid and turned his attention to seek the Lord; and proclaimed a fast throughout all Judah.  Then Jehoshaphat stood in the assembly of Judah and Jerusalem, in the house of the Lord before the new court, and he said, ‘O Lord, the God of our fathers, art Thou not God in the heavens?  And art Thou not ruler over all the kingdoms of the nations?  Power and might are in Thy hand so that no one can stand against Thee.” II Chronicles 20:3, 5-6

Jehoshaphat goes on to remind God of a few great defeats He has caused for His enemies through His people and asks for help.  Here is how God answered Him:

“thus says the Lord to you, ‘Do not fear or be dismayed because of this great multitude, for the battle is not yours but God’s.  Tomorrow go down against them. -- You need not fight in this battle; station yourselves, stand and see the salvation of the Lord on your behalf.  O Judah and Jerusalem.’  Do not fear or be dismayed; tomorrow go out and face them for the Lord is with you!” selections of II Chronicles 20:15-17

“And when they began singing and praising, the Lord set ambushes against the sons of Ammon, Moab, and Mount Seir who had come against Judah; so they were routed” II Chronicles 20:22

In a way, this battle could represent how having everything is never enough to ensure winning.  Jehoshaphat humbly appealed to the Lord.  And was given strange council. 

He believed the Lord and directed the people to the place God told him.  The people arrived and they sang…yes, you read right, they sang praises to the Lord and HE fought the battle for them – they just watched!  Just think about that…even when we least expect it the Lord is fighting our battles!

Deaf Ears or Not?


“Then Jehoshaphat the king of Judah returned in safety to his house in Jerusalem.  And Jehu the son of Hannai the seer went out to meet him and said to King Jehoshaphat, ‘Should you help the wicked and love those who hate the Lord and so bring wrath on yourself from the Lord?  But there is some good in you for you have removed the Asheroth from the land and you have set your heart to seek God.’

“So Jehoshaphat lived in Jerusalem and went out again among the people from Beersheba to the hill country of Ephriam and brought them back to the Lord, the God of their fathers.” II Chronicles 19:1-4

The Lord loves us and He longs for us to listen to Him and turn from our own desires and selfish needs.  No one can satisfy the emptiness in the human heart, but Father God. 

He calls to us and offers living water and the bread of life.  He promises we will always have food, clothing and shelter and His love.  Sometimes these promises and offers fall on deaf ears and yet some stay attuned to His Words and love.
